Natrialba Kamekura and Dyall-Smith 1996, gen. nov.
Type species: ¤ Natrialba asiatica Kamekura and Dyall-Smith 1996.
Recommended three-letter abbreviation: Nab. (see the file ¤ "Three-letter code for abbreviations of generic names").
Etymology: N.L. n. natron (arbitrarily derived from the Arabic n. natrun or natron) soda, sodium carbonate; L. adj. alba, white; L. fem. n. Natrialba, sodium white; referring to the high sodium ion requirement and the pigmentless colonies of the type species.
Valid publication: Validation List no. 57. Int. J. Syst. Bacteriol., 1996, 46, 625-626.
Effective publication: KAMEKURA (M.) and DYALL-SMITH (M.L.): Taxonomy of the family Halobacteriaceae and the description of two new genera Halorubrobacterium and Natrialba. J. Gen. Appl. Microbiol., 1995, 41, 333-350.

Natrialba aegyptia corrig. Hezayen et al. 2001, sp. nov.
Type strain: (see also Global Catalogue of Microorganisms) 40 = DSM 13077 = JCM 11194 = NBRC 102636.
Sequence accession no. (16S rRNA gene) for the type strain: AF251941.
Etymology: L. fem. adj. aegyptia, pertaining to Egypt, referring to the geographical region from which this organism was isolated.

Notes:
1 The original spelling of the specific epithet aegyptiaca, has been corrected by the List Editor, IJSEM.
Reference: LIST EDITOR, IJSEM: Notification that new names and new combinations have appeared in volume 51, part 3, of the IJSEM. Int. J. Syst. Evol. Microbiol. 2001, 51, 1231-1233.
Notification List in IJSEM Online
2 The Lists Editor has corrected the original spelling of the specific epithet aegyptiaca to aegyptia. However, the Latin adjective aegyptiacus -a -um has been used by Aulus Gellius (a grammarian of the second century A.D.) and, later, by Saint Jerome. Examples (i) Aulus Gellius: Noctes Atticae, Liber X, paragraph 10: Causam esse huius rei Apion in libris aegyptiacis hanc dicit, ... (ii) Saint Jerome: Latin Vulgate, Genesis 41, 45 ... et vocavit eum lingua aegyptiaca ...
3 The Subcommittee on the taxonomy of Halobacteriaceae recommendes the use of the name Natrialba aegyptiaca.

Natrialba magadii (Tindall et al. 1984) Kamekura et al. 1997, comb. nov.
Type strain: (see also Global Catalogue of Microorganisms) MS3 = ATCC 43099= CIP 104546 = DSM 3394 = JCM 8861 = NBRC 102185 = NCIMB 2190.
Sequence accession no. (16S rRNA gene) for the type strain: X72495, CP001932 (complete genome).
Basonym: ¤ Natronobacterium magadii Tindall et al. 1984.
Etymology: N.L. gen. n. magadii, of Magadi; named for Lake Magadi, a saline soda lake in Kenya.

Natrialba taiwanensis Hezayen et al. 2001, sp. nov.
Type strain: (see also Global Catalogue of Microorganisms) B1T = DSM 12281 = JCM 9577 = NBRC 102640.
Sequence accession no. (16S rRNA gene) for the type strain: D14124.
Etymology: N.L. fem. adj. taiwanensis, pertaining to Taiwan, referring to the isolation of the organism from solar salts produced in Taiwan.

Notes:
1 The type strain of Natrialba taiwanensis Hezayen et al. 2001 was originally classified as ¤ Natrialba asiatica.
2 The specific epithet taiwanensis is a Neo Latin adjective in the feminine gender, not a Neo Latin noun in the genitive case as cited by Hezayen et al. 2001.
